Love, Differently
Join Dr. Caleb Stephens for a presentation that navigates through the complexities of love as it relates to race, masculinity, and truth.
Caleb Stephens, Ph.D., is a dually licensed LMSW (licensed master social worker) and a LMAC (licensed master addiction counselor). He has worked in child welfare, addiction treatment, schools, psychiatric residential treatment facilities, with incarcerated individuals, and has been a community organizer and activist for the last decade. Stephens’ research areas are the Black narrative, safety, hope, empowerment, intentionality and authenticity.
